Well off the beaten path, The Joint serves up what is often argued as the best barbecue in the Crescent City. Passersby may miss this tiny barbecue café at first glance, but the fragrant smell of the smoking meat keeps the restaurant going unnoticed. The Joint menu features all of the barbecue basics including brisket, pulled pork, chicken and ribs. Side options include cole slaw, potato salad, macaroni and cheese, and baked beans. Finish a meal with a slice of pecan, key lime, or peanut butter pie. - Bethany Culp
